Midwest furniture and mattress retailer Art Van has announced that retail veteran Keri Durkin has joined the company as vice president franchise development, reporting to Steve Glucksman, senior vice president of business development.

New orders in June rose 6% over June of 2016 and 6% year-to-date according to a report by the Smith Leonard accounting and consulting firm.

Earlier this week home furnishings icon IKEA announced its plans to open its largest store in the world in Seoul, South Korea looking beyond threats from Kim Jong Un to destroy its’ southern neighbor.

The fallout from Hurricane Harvey continues to devastate, impacting Texas, Louisiana and beyond. According to AccuWeather, the heaviest rain and the greatest risk of flooding on a regional basis will extend northeastward from near the border of Texas and Louisiana to northern Louisiana, southeastern Arkansas, and northwestern Mississippi.

Outdoor furnishings resource Woodard has provided product for two stunning outdoor spaces as part of their recent collaboration with Traditional Home Magazine for the 2017 Hampton Designer Showcase in Southampton, NY.

Furniture chain RoomPlace opened its newest store in Indianapolis this summer with a fresh new look hoping to wow customers in their new market on the East side of the city.

Multi-brand retailer Mattress1One has committed to assisting with relief efforts pledging $350,000 in cash, mattresses and box springs to those affected by Hurricane Harvey.
